REQUESTING THE CLERK-TREASURER TO CERTIFY TO
THE LIFE OF THE PROPOSED IMPROVEMENT, TO-WIT-
THE MUNICIPAL COMPLEX AND CERTIFYING TO THE
MAXIMUM OF THE MATURITIES OF OBLIGATIONS TO
BE ENTERED INTO.
WHEREAS, this City now proposes to enter into construction
of a City Complex in accordance with plans and specifications as
p~epa~ed by Keith Haig $ Associates, A~¢hiteet$, and
WHEREAS, it now appears that it will be necessary to issue
a general obligation note without the vote of the people in the sum
of $~25,000.00.
BE IT RESOLVED by the Council of the City of Faimlawn,
Summit County, Ohio:
Section 1.
That the Clerk-Treasurer be and he is hereby directed
to certify to this Council as to the proposed life
of an improvement to be known as the Fairlawn
Municipal Complex to be constructed and to further
certify as to the maximum life of maturities
that may be issued for a certain general obli-
gation note of the City of Fairlawn in the sum
of $~25,000.00.
Section 2.
That this Resolution shall be in full force and
effect fPom and aftem its enactment.
